Transaction 6f81c8373e40bfb547104d95dc99e3ce26500e0c7262d0109a103a6a6e28deec
1 Input
1 Output
-
6f81c8373e40bfb547104d95dc99e3ce26500e0c7262d0109a103a6a6e28deec:0
- value
- 1966156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a35a69ced5e9f121333527f283cb81a62064169 OP_EQUAL
- address
- 36zoPPsJAkjYcAiWB6CWZeUHv4v8wc76fH